In this position...
Work through the process of taking sheet metal (Steel & Aluminum) from early FEAS to running at rate in the stamping plants.
This includes early transfer studies for FEAS, working with processing and die design groups to create Automation Start Package for die design, die checks to ensure proper clearance, follow automation through design and build phases, perform simulations for the creation of curve profiles and output files for download to the press, support in person launch with automation and curves until running at rate.
Support plants with die/automation relocation and insource actions along with emergency offloads in the event of a press breakdown.
